Of a BYU Romani intern. So, I'm sorry it's been so long since an update, I just haven't had many photos to add. But, I realized that not everyone really knows what I"m doing here in Romania. So, this is how my day went down today:

7:30 am - I woke up and showered and shaved and had some granola and yogurt for breakfast.
8:30 am - Left with Kinsey and Robby to catch the 20 minute tram to the Dancu apartments, which is where there are 3 orphans that are taken care of by different caretakers that work there in shifts.
9:00 am - 12:00 pm - We basically just played with the kids at Dancu. Kinsey and I started doing our Brigance testing with the kids there, which is an assessment test of a child's development.
12:00-2:00pm - Lunch break, but we didn't get back till 12:40 because the tram took a crazy route today. For lunch, I made some eggs and toast with this spreadable cheese on it. Then Robby made some chicken noodle soup and was like, "Hey, I can't eat all of this, you want some" and I was like "Okay". So I ate it and it was good. Then we left at 1:40pm to walk to the Hospital.
2:00-5:00pm - Our role at the hospital is to change diapers of any children their that have no mothers, and then spend time with them holding them and playing with them and feeding them. So, we pair up usually and divide up which floors and which wings of those floors we'll cover and then go ask the nurses in those "Aveti copii fara mamii?" (pronounced ah-VETS co-PEE FUH-ruh MAH-mee) which means "Do you have any children without mothers?" and get to work. Today I changed a girl's diaper that had a cleft palate. It was my first time changing a poopy diaper and I did it all by myself. It probably took me like 5 minutes, but she didn't cry at all. I wish I could say I didn't get any poop on my hands. . . but I did. Then I went and held my favorite baby, Pamela, who I'm with in the photo. I got to feed her today and I tried to burp her, also, but she wasn't having any of that.
